Vic20 Mischief: How a Teenage Prank Sparked My Interest in Programming

cartoon of a shop assistant in a computer store
Hey there, fellow tech enthusiasts! Today, I want to take you on a nostalgic journey back to the 1980s when I was just a mischievous teenage boy armed with a Commodore Vic20 and an insatiable curiosity for all things tech. Back in those days, personal computers were still relatively new and exciting, and I couldn't resist the temptation to have a bit of fun with them.

Early experiences with computers like the Commodore Vic20 often sparked curiosity and creativity, leading many people into careers in software development.

Discovering the Vic20

Picture this: It was the '80s, and Commodore Vic20 computers were all the rage. You could find them in electronics stores like Dixons and even at unexpected places like Boots the Chemist. These computers were encased in metal display boxes, making them the perfect playground for a mischievous teen like me.

The Perfect Prank

The setup was simple but effective. I had committed a tiny BASIC program to memory – a program that would wreak havoc in the most harmless way possible. It was just about ten lines long, but it was enough to turn an innocent Vic20 into an instrument of chaos.

Here's how it worked:
  1. I'd saunter into one of these stores and nonchalantly approach the Vic20 on display.
  2. With the confidence of a tech-savvy teen, I'd quickly type in my carefully memorized program.
  3. The program was designed to start a timer for about 60 seconds, and then crank up the volume to full blast.
  4. After the countdown, the Vic20 would emit an annoying, high-pitched sound that could wake the dead.
  5. The final twist: I programmed it to lock the keyboard. No matter what the frantic store staff pressed, they couldn't silence the alarm.
  6. The only way out for them was to find the key, unlock the enclosure, and either remove the power supply or cycle the power to stop the commotion.
As soon as I hit the "RUN" command, I'd make a hasty exit, knowing that the Vic20 would play the siren-like alarm, causing chaos and confusion behind me.

Looking back, it's clear that my friends and I were quite the teenage troublemakers, finding endless entertainment in this tech prank. The alarm wasn't some sophisticated sound system; it was just a tiny speaker playing a simple, high-pitched note. But to our teenage ears, it was the epitome of hilarity.

Back in 2017, I Thought Petrol Cars Might Disappear by 2025

Tiger kit car built as a personal engineering and automotive project
So I'm on a train on my way down to Cumbernauld for the weekend. I have Jamie (age 9) with me, and he is delighted to be on a train. It's diesel-electric. Onboarding, I pointed out the massive turbo on the side of the train just below the level of the platform. (I'm an engineer, I notice these things...)

The Diesel engine powers a generator to make electric energy to turn a massive induction motor that makes it move, I tell Jamie.

It's quiet, but you can just hear the engine's dull drone as we fly through the countryside. I'm guessing being diesel-electric, it is more efficient than pure diesel and also cleaner.

Travelling Through a Changing World

I was also on a bus this morning on the way to work. It was one of Aberdeen's new hydrogen-powered fleet. Diesel buses have been abandoned in favour of turning hydrogen into electricity, which again powers a motor to make the bus move. This bus is almost silent apart from some transmission noise on the move. When stopped, there is no noise at all. Great for commuters like me tapping on my iPhone and writing my blog.

The big problem, as I see it, is whether petrol and diesel cars will still be on the road in 2025. In only eight years' time.

The Fear That Petrol Cars Might Vanish

I read an article while having my lunch today, which was a report by Stanford University that is predicting that fossil fuel cars will vanish in less than EIGHT years time! The report suggests that as electric cars become cheaper, 'Big Oil' and the petroleum industry will collapse. People will have no choice but to invest in electric cars. Electric cars will become cheaper, more reliable and travel further.

It painted a picture of petrol and diesel cars being abandoned. No longer being economical to run. Petrol stations would close and become increasingly difficult to find. Spare parts would stop being made. Garages will no longer repair the current generation of cars. The falling oil price is predicted to fall further.

So it may be game over for the little Abarth and my 4x4. Eight years does not seem that far away. What's their fate in years to come, abandoned, in the 2025 fuel crisis?

Imagining an Electric Future

For my Lotus Seven kit car, I'm not so worried. I built it after all. As technology changed, I could even imagine replacing the petrol engine with a large electric motor and modern battery systems. Possibly both were donated by a crash-damaged modern electric car. The performance could be better than the current petrol engine.

My kit car has a simple 12-volt electric system with a separate wire harness for the engine. So, to remove the petrol engine and its ECU would be easy. It would leave big holes where the engine, gearbox and petrol tank lived. These can be replaced by the motor's ECU, batteries or fuel cell. Who knows, I may be able to put a motor per wheel and make it four-wheel drive. That would be fun.

All the other electric systems would remain unchanged. There are no antilock brakes or traction control. It's really only lights and a horn left when the engines are gone.

It should be lighter too, if I could get a range of 200 or so miles, that would be ideal. It doesn't go much further on a tank of petrol at the moment. It's not very comfortable for long distances, so the majority of driving I do is just a quick blast in evenings and weekends.
